1. What happened?

It appears that a mistake was made during the surveying process, causing the house to be built on the wrong lot.

2. Who is responsible for the mistake?

The responsibility for the mistake lies with the surveying company or individual who incorrectly marked the property lines.

3. Can the mistake be fixed?

Yes, the mistake can be fixed by either moving the house to the correct lot or adjusting the property lines to include the house on the correct lot.

4. What are the potential consequences of this mistake?

The consequences of this mistake can include legal disputes between the homeowners, the surveying company, and the original property owner. It may also result in financial losses for all parties involved.

5. How can this be prevented in the future?

This mistake can be prevented by ensuring that all surveys are carefully and accurately conducted, and by double-checking the property lines before beginning construction on any new building.
